DR. JEFFREY LANG is Professor of Mathematics at the University of Kansas, Lawrence, Kansas. His other works include: Struggling to Surrender: Some Impressions of an American Convert to Islam and Losing My Religion: A Call for Help.
Jeffrey Lang
Author details
- Born:
- Jan. 30, 1954